Critical AutomationDirect PLC Vulnerabilities Expose Manufacturing to Cyber Risk in 2025

In October 2025, AutomationDirect disclosed multiple critical vulnerabilities affecting its Productivity Suite and a range of Productivity 1000, 2000, and 3000 PLC models, widely deployed in the manufacturing sector. Discovered by Nozomi Networks, the flaws—such as remote code execution, weak password recovery, and unrestricted file system access—could allow unauthenticated attackers to gain full control of affected devices, compromise sensitive project files, and disrupt industrial processes. The vulnerabilities could be exploited remotely with low attack complexity and no user interaction. This incident highlights rising risks posed by legacy and poorly segmented OT networks, as threat actors increasingly target industrial control systems. The sharp jump in the number and severity of disclosed PLC software vulnerabilities underscores the urgent need for enhanced segmentation, access controls, and monitoring in critical infrastructure environments.

CISA Raises Alarm on Schneider Electric & Vertikal ICS Vulnerabilities (2025)

In October 2025, CISA released urgent advisories for three significant industrial control system (ICS) vulnerabilities affecting Schneider Electric EcoStruxure, Vertikal Systems Hospital Manager Backend Services, and Schneider Electric Modicon. The vulnerabilities, discovered through active monitoring and intelligence efforts, could allow unauthorized access, system manipulation, or disruption if exploited by threat actors. These issues expose critical infrastructure, including healthcare and industrial automation environments, to increased risk of cyberattacks that could impact operations, safety, and patient care. CISA highlighted immediate mitigations and urged organizations to review and apply them to safeguard their assets. The frequency of high-severity ICS vulnerabilities underscores an ongoing trend of targeting operational technology environments, in both healthcare and industrial sectors. These risks are magnified by legacy platforms, the rise of ransomware, and increasingly sophisticated attackers. Regulatory scrutiny and mandates for rapid patching, segmentation, and real-time detection are on the rise as a result.

Hitachi Energy TropOS ICS Flaws Threaten Critical Infrastructure Security (2025)

In October 2025, Hitachi Energy disclosed multiple critical vulnerabilities in its TropOS 4th Generation firmware (versions 8.9.6.0 and prior), widely used in critical manufacturing and energy sectors. Three CVEs—CVE-2025-1036, CVE-2025-1037, and CVE-2025-1038—were identified, including OS command injection and improper privilege management flaws in the web-based configuration utility. Exploiting these, authenticated attackers could escalate privileges and obtain root SSH access to affected devices, substantially compromising network security and potentially disrupting critical infrastructure operations. The flaws were reported by Idaho National Laboratory’s CyTRICS program and carry CVSS v4 scores between 7.5 and 8.7. This incident highlights ongoing risks posed by authentication and privilege flaws in industrial control systems (ICS), especially as critical infrastructure devices increasingly attract remote exploitation attempts. It underscores the urgent need for regular firmware updates, network segmentation, and robust access controls amid tightening regulations and persistent adversarial interest in ICS environments.

CISA Alert: Active Exploits Target Dassault DELMIA Apriso and XWiki in 2025

In October 2025, cybersecurity authorities including CISA confirmed active exploitation of critical vulnerabilities in Dassault Systèmes DELMIA Apriso and XWiki platforms. Threat actors leveraged flaws such as CVE-2025-6204—an 8.0 CVSS code injection bug—to gain unauthorized access and potential code execution on affected systems. The attackers exploited unpatched systems to facilitate lateral movement, data exfiltration, and possible disruption of manufacturing and enterprise workflows. Affected organizations faced immediate operational risk and the prospect of sensitive information compromise. This incident highlights a growing trend in rapid exploitation of recently disclosed enterprise software vulnerabilities. With increased attacker focus on supply chain and collaborative platforms, organizations must respond swiftly to new advisories and prioritize vulnerability management programs to reduce exposure to high-severity threats.

Oracle EBS Zero-Day Attack Triggers Global Supply Chain Crisis in 2025

In early 2025, multiple organizations experienced cyberattacks stemming from the exploitation of a critical zero-day vulnerability (CVE-2025-61882) in Oracle E-Business Suite (EBS). Threat actors leveraged this flaw to gain unauthorized access, deploy covert tools, and move laterally within victim environments. Notably, high-profile companies such as Schneider Electric may have been impacted, highlighting the sophistication and stealthiness of the attackers, who exploited encrypted and east-west traffic blind spots. The compromise of sensitive business data and disruption of enterprise resource planning systems underscore the far-reaching operational and financial consequences of this campaign. This incident sheds light on the escalating trend of supply chain attacks targeting widely used enterprise software through previously unknown vulnerabilities. The breadth of the campaign and the use of zero-day exploits signal a need for continuous vigilance, rapid patching, and advanced detection controls to defend critical systems against emerging threats.

Active Exploitation of Dassault DELMIA Apriso Vulnerabilities Impacts Manufacturing Sector

In June 2024, CISA issued an alert highlighting active exploitation of two vulnerabilities (CVE-2024-22120 and CVE-2024-22121) within Dassault Systèmes’ DELMIA Apriso platform, a widely used manufacturing operations management solution. The flaws, found in DELMIA Apriso Release 2017 to 2023, allow unauthenticated attackers to execute remote code, potentially compromising production environments and exposing sensitive operational data. Attackers are leveraging these vulnerabilities to target the manufacturing sector for automated ransomware deployment and data exfiltration, resulting in operational disruption and risk to production integrity. This incident underscores the trend of threat actors focusing on supply chain and OT/IT hybrid platforms, exploiting unpatched flaws for initial access. The urgent CISA advisory signals accelerating regulatory scrutiny and highlights the increased risks posed by software supply chain weaknesses in critical infrastructure sectors.

North Korea’s Lazarus Group Breaches Drone Developers in 2023 Cyber-Espionage Campaign

In March 2023, the Lazarus Group—an advanced persistent threat attributed to North Korea—successfully targeted three European companies in the defense sector involved in drone development. Leveraging Operation DreamJob, the attackers used social engineering tactics, including fraudulent job offers and a trojanized PDF reader, to gain initial access via phishing emails. The deployment of the ScoringMathTea remote access trojan enabled complete control over compromised systems, potentially allowing sensitive data exfiltration related to unmanned aerial vehicle (UAV) technology and manufacturing know-how. ESET researchers linked the attack to ongoing North Korean efforts to bolster domestic drone capabilities and noted the victims' support of military deployments in Ukraine. The incident exemplifies the persistent and adaptive nature of sophisticated state-linked cyber-espionage campaigns targeting high-value defense technologies. As strategic competition and armed conflicts persist, such tactics have become more prevalent against organizations with intellectual property critical to national security.

Ransomware Attack on Asahi Disrupts Brewery Operations and Beer Supply in 2024

In early June 2024, the Japanese beverage giant Asahi Group was hit by a ransomware attack that significantly disrupted its domestic brewery operations. Threat actors targeted the company's IT systems, crippling order processing and distribution networks for several days, which led to product shortages and impacted supply chain partners and customers. Asahi confirmed that while immediate containment steps were taken and an investigation was launched, operational downtime and order backlogs persisted as recovery efforts continued, demonstrating the real-world impact of cyberattacks on manufacturing and logistics. This incident highlights the rising trend of ransomware gangs targeting critical sectors like manufacturing, exploiting supply chain dependencies to maximize business disruption and force rapid ransom demands. With attackers increasingly prioritizing operational technology and just-in-time industries, organizations must revisit segmentation, east-west controls, and rapid incident response capabilities to keep pace.

'PassiveNeuron' SQL Server Attacks Expose Global Sectors to Espionage

In early 2024, a cyber-espionage campaign attributed to the 'PassiveNeuron' threat group targeted organizations in government, industrial, and financial sectors across Asia, Africa, and Latin America. Attackers exploited vulnerable SQL servers as entry points, deploying custom malware to stealthily exfiltrate sensitive data and facilitate lateral movement within compromised environments. The adversaries demonstrated a high degree of operational security, leveraging encrypted channels and bespoke tooling to evade conventional detection, resulting in significant data exposure and operational disruptions for affected entities. This incident reflects the increasing sophistication of cyber-espionage actors leveraging less-monitored databases and novel malware. It highlights a shift toward stealthy, persistent attacks against critical sectors—signaling the need for robust internal monitoring, segmentation, and east-west traffic controls to counter evolving threats.

Blue Angel Suite Faces 2024 Webctrl.cgi OS Command Injection Attempts

In October 2024, threat actors attempted to exploit an OS command injection vulnerability targeting the Blue Angel Software Suite's web interface on embedded Linux devices. Attackers issued crafted POST requests to the '/cgi-bin/webctrl.cgi' endpoint, aiming to inject arbitrary shell commands via the 'ipaddress' parameter. These attacks, detected by honeypots, mirror previous vulnerabilities such as CVE-2025-34033, which allows authenticated attackers to execute code as root by manipulating input passed to system commands like 'ping'. The incidents highlight persistent risks across IoT and broadband equipment, potentially providing attackers with full system control. This incident underscores a growing trend in targeting network appliances and IoT infrastructure for initial access and lateral movement. As regulatory attention increases and attackers shift toward exploiting device misconfigurations and weak input validation, robust segmentation and up-to-date patch management are even more critical.

Two CVSS 10.0 Flaws in Red Lion RTUs Expose Industrial Control Environments

In October 2025, two critical vulnerabilities (CVE-2023-40151 and CVE-2023-42770) were publicly disclosed in Red Lion Sixnet RTU devices, which are widely used for industrial automation and critical infrastructure. Both flaws received a CVSS 10.0 rating, underscoring their exploitability and impact. Attackers exploiting these vulnerabilities could achieve remote code execution with the highest privileges, granting them full control over affected devices. These RTUs are often deployed in energy, utilities, and manufacturing, raising concerns about the potential for business disruption, safety risks, and further attacks via compromised operational technology networks. This incident is particularly relevant as it highlights how legacy and specialized industrial control systems remain a prime target for threat actors leveraging zero-day vulnerabilities. The convergence of IT and OT, combined with growing regulatory scrutiny and an uptick in supply chain exposures, means that organizations must refocus on asset visibility and patch management for embedded and hard-to-update devices.

PassiveNeuron: Unraveling the 2024–2025 Advanced Persistent Attack on Global Servers

Between June 2024 and August 2025, the advanced persistent threat (APT) campaign codenamed "PassiveNeuron" targeted government, financial, and industrial organizations primarily across Asia, Africa, and Latin America. Attackers exploited SQL servers—likely leveraging vulnerabilities or credential brute-forcing—to gain initial access, followed by repeated attempts to deploy web shells. When thwarted by robust endpoint protections, the attackers escalated to advanced techniques, implementing a multi-stage DLL loader chain to deliver custom implants ('Neursite' and 'NeuralExecutor') and leveraging Cobalt Strike for lateral movement and persistence. These tools enabled sophisticated data gathering, process management, and network proxying, all while leveraging various encryption and obfuscation tactics to evade detection. This incident exemplifies the ongoing evolution of targeted cyberespionage against server infrastructure, with attribution leaning towards a Chinese-speaking threat actor based on tactics and C2 infrastructure, though with some ambiguity due to apparent false flags. It reflects a rise in multi-stage, stealthy attacks leveraging both custom and widely abused tools, highlighting the elevated risk posed to internet-exposed critical servers.
